HMRG
HMRG is a fluorescent dye, which serves as the fluorescent active product generated by enzyme-activated fluorescent probes targeting proteases and glycosidases. Its detection mechanism relies on the intramolecular spirocyclization equilibrium: HMRG itself exists in an open non-spirocyclic structure under physiological pH, which maintains a conjugated π system and produces strong fluorescence; whereas its probe precursors (such as Leu-HMRG, Ac-GlyPro-HMRG and βGal-HMRG) exist in a closed spirocyclic form and show no fluorescence due to the disruption of the π-conjugated system; when the target enzyme cleaves the substrate fragment linked to the probe precursor, the closed spirocyclic structure converts to the open structure of HMRG, restoring the conjugated system and generating a strong fluorescent signal. Its detection wavelength is Ex/Em = 501/524 nm.
